    Celeste Collins is the Executive Director of OnTrack Financial Education Counseling, formerly Consumer Credit Counseling Service of Western North Carolina. OnTrack WNC is a nonprofit, which serves the western 18 counties of NC helping people reach their money and housing goals through education, counseling and support. Celeste joined the agency in 1993 and over the years has been a credit counselor, housing counselor, educator, grant writer, marketing director, and fundraiser. Prior to joining the agency, Celeste spent 10 years with First Union National Bank; her last position with the bank was Vice President, Regional Sales & Marketing Manager for the 88-branch western region. A passion for helping people manage their money and credit better inspired Celeste to leave her job in banking to work with OnTrack WNC. Celeste graduated from UNC-Chapel Hill with a BS in Business Administration with a concentration in accounting. Celeste’s community involvement includes: UNC Asheville Department of Management and Accountancy Advisory Board, WNC Nonprofit Pathways Advisory Committee member, Buncombe County’s Aging Plan Steering Committee, Asheville Downtown Rotary Club, Asheville Homelessness Initiative Finance Committee, Friday Fellows Wildacres Leadership Initiative, and First Baptist Church. Celeste received the Asheville Chamber of Commerce Athena Leadership Award in 2010 and was a YWCA 2011 TWIN honoree in the Empowerment category.
